Smaller Airports with Scheduled Flights / Air Taxi Service ...
- Springfield Airport (SGF/KSGF)
(38 miles [61.2 km] to the south southwest)
- Waynesville - St. Robert Rgnl. (TBN/KTBN)
(60 miles [96.6 km] to the east)
- Joplin Rgnl. (JLN/KJLN)
(81 miles [130.4 km] to the west southwest)
- Branson Meml. (ICAO: KBBG)
(86 miles [138.4 km] to the south)
- Columbia Rgnl. (COU/KCOU)
(90 miles [144.8 km] to the northeast)
- Boone Co. Airport (HRO/KHRO)
(105 miles [169 km] to the south)
General Aviation Airports ...
- Buffalo Muni. (FAA ID: H17)
(12 miles [19.3 km] to the southeast)
- Bolivar Muni. (FAA ID: M17)
(14 miles [22.5 km] to the south southwest)
- Osceola Muni. (FAA ID: 3MO)
(28 miles [45.1 km] to the northwest)
- Stockton Muni. (FAA ID: MO3)
(32 miles [51.5 km] to the west southwest)
- Camdenton Meml. (FAA ID: H21)
(33 miles [53.1 km] to the east northeast)
